Least Populated State of India as per Census 2011 – Sikkim
Sikkim is the least-populated state in India.
- Capital- Gangtok
- Population of Sikkim: 6,07,688
- Sikkim is the second-smallest state in India.
- In 1975, Sikkim joined India as its 22nd state.
Current Population of India: most populated state(Updated)
Current Population of India: In India, the census is conducted every 10 years. According to the latest United Nations Population Fund data, India’s population in 2023 will stand at 142.86 crore. India has overtaken China, which has 142.57 crore, becoming the most populous country in the world. The top five countries in terms of population in decreasing order are India, China, the US, Indonesia, and Pakistan, according to the UNFPA report. In terms of area, China is the third largest country & India is the seventh largest in the world. The census was about to happen in 2021 but got delayed due to COVID-19.
